The pale Dortmund brew, the only beer bottled by DAB for many years, was always produced from the finest ingredients by state-of-the-art brewing processes.
For special achievements in brewing, DAB was also awarded the Prussian State Medal, the highest honour then available, at Düsseldorf in 1913.
Nowadays, DAB is still one of Germany's major export brands and is represented in 20 countries throughout the world.
